So my fiance and I have received the noa2 about two weeks ago...and now I am working on the I-134 affidavit of support. Since I am a college student and only work part time my dad is my joint or co sponsor.

My question is what exactly do I send out to my fiance?

Is it just these or is there more to it?

1. Completed I-134 (from me and my co sponsor)

2. 6 Most Recent Pay Stubs (from me and my co sponsor)

3. Letter from the employer stating time of employment, salary and in good standing (from me and my co sponsor)

4. Statement from the bank stating when the account was opened and the current balance (from me and my co sponsor)

5. Letter of intent that I still want to marry him (from me)

6. More evidence from a ongoing relationship (from me)

7. Tax returns

is this it? Or is there more to it? If so please let me know!

Looks good. Personally I'd want to add proof of co-sponsors identity(copy of driver's license or birth cert.) since they don't already have that established.

Regarding the interview it's probably country specific. Receiving packet 3(through mail/snail mail) is usually the first step. Hopefully someone from the same country will be helpful. Otherwise call NVC, talk to a person, get NVC/embassy case number, track on dhl or call embassy/DOS to inquire about the embassy receiving K1 application.

K1 process, October 2010 > POE, July 2011

I-129F approved in 180 days from NOA1 date. (195 days from filing to NOA2 in hand)

Interview took 224 days from I-129F NOA1 date. (241 days from filing petition until visa in hand)

From filing I-129F petition until POE: 285 days

Click timeline or "about me" for all details.

AOS process, December 2011 > July 2012

EAD/AP Approval took 51 days from NOA1 date to email update. (77 days from filing until EAD/AP in hand)

AOS Approval took 206 days from NOA1 date to email update. (231 days from filing until greencard in hand)

From filing I-129F petition until greencard in hand: 655 days
